Abstract

The utility model provides a magnetic attraction plug-in type neck hanging bracket which comprises a scarf component, a clamping device and a connecting rod. The scarf component comprises more than two scarf supports which are connected in a plugging mode to be hung on the neck of a user, a magnetic attraction structure used for providing magnetic attraction for a plugging state after plugging is arranged between at least one group of scarf supports which are mutually plugged, and at least one scarf support is a rear scarf located at the rear part of the neck of the user. The utility model adopts the sectional scarf structure, so that a user does not need to sleeve the bracket from the head into the neck, and when the scarf is used, the pluggable scarf bracket is separated and then can be worn, thereby being convenient for the user to wear. Furthermore, the magnetic attraction structure is further arranged in the plug-in structure to provide magnetic attraction and retention for the plug-in state, so that the use of the plug-in structure by a user is facilitated. The back scarf is deformable structure, and the user can adjust the back scarf according to self actual demand, has promoted user's use experience.

Background
With economic development and social progress, electronic devices (such as mobile phones and tablet computers) are increasingly widely used in life, and more scenes need to use the electronic devices, so that the mobile phones become an indispensable part of people. In some special scenarios, in order to free both hands and avoid holding the electronic device for a long time, designers have invented a neck-hanging bracket.
The neck hanging bracket is a bracket which can be hung on the neck of a user. The hanging neck type support in the prior art is found in the actual use process, a user needs to sleeve the support from the head of the user to the neck when wearing the hanging neck type support, the user also needs to take out the hanging neck type support from the head of the user when taking down the support, the hair can shield the support when the hair of the user is longer, the hanging neck type support is inconvenient to wear and take down, and the use experience of the user is affected.

As shown in fig. 1, in particular, the magnetic attraction plug-in type neck hanging bracket comprises a scarf assembly 19, a clamping device 1 and a connecting rod 2. Preferably, the scarf assembly 19 includes 3 scarf brackets connected in a plugging manner to hang on the user's neck, wherein a magnetic structure for providing magnetic attraction for the plugging state after plugging is arranged between a group of scarf brackets plugged with each other. One of them muffler support is the back muffler 7 that is located user's neck rear portion, and back muffler 7 is flexible structure, and is preferable, is provided with the flexible piece of deformability in the back muffler 7. The remaining neck brace is a front neck brace 20 that is positioned in front of the user's neck.
Preferably, the clamping device 1 is used for clamping electronic equipment (such as a mobile phone, a tablet computer, a display and a camera), one end of the connecting rod 2 is connected with the clamping device 1, and the other end of the connecting rod 2 is connected with the front scarf 20.
Further, the front scarf 20 includes a first front scarf 5 and a second front scarf 4, and the front end of the first front scarf 5 and the front end of the second front scarf 4 are connected in a plugging manner. The rear end of the first front scarf 5 is connected with one end of the rear scarf 7 in a plug-in mode, and the rear end of the second front scarf 4 is connected with the other end of the rear scarf 7 in a plug-in mode.
Preferably, the front end of the first front scarf 5 and the front end of the second front scarf 4 are provided with magnetic attraction structures, the rear end of the first front scarf 5 and the rear scarf 7 are provided with magnetic attraction structures, and the rear end of the second front scarf 4 and the rear scarf 7 are provided with magnetic attraction structures. The magnetic structure is used for facilitating the use of plug connection by a user and providing magnetic retention for the plug connection.
In another embodiment, only the front end of the first front scarf 5 and the front end of the second front scarf 4 are provided with magnetic attraction structures, the rear end of the first front scarf 5 is in plug connection with one end of the rear scarf 7, and the rear end of the second front scarf 4 is in plug connection with the other end of the rear scarf 7. In other embodiments, only one of the positions where the first front scarf 5, the second front scarf 4 and the rear scarf 7 are connected is provided with a magnetic structure, and the other connecting positions are in plug connection.
In the first embodiment, as shown in fig. 2, 3 and 8, the front ends of the first front scarf 5 and the second front scarf 4 adopt a plug-in structure, and the plug-in structure includes: the front end of the first front scarf 5 is provided with a first protrusion 37 or a first groove 36, the front end of the second front scarf 4 is provided with a first groove 36 or a first protrusion 37, and the first groove 36 and the first protrusion 37 are coupled to realize plug connection.
Further, the first protrusion 37 is provided with a first magnetic attraction piece 12 or a second magnetic attraction piece 21, the first groove 36 is internally provided with the second magnetic attraction piece 21 or the first magnetic attraction piece 12, and after the first protrusion 37 is inserted into the first groove 36, the first magnetic attraction piece 12 is magnetically attracted with the second magnetic attraction piece 21 to realize a magnetic attraction structure.
Preferably, as shown in FIG. 2, the scarf joint 3 is disposed on the second front scarf 4, the first groove 36 is disposed on the front end of the second front scarf 4, and the first magnetic element 12 is disposed in the first groove 36. The second front scarf 4 comprises a second front scarf upper cover 9 and a second front scarf lower cover 41 which are fixed up and down, and third grooves 15 are formed in the second front scarf upper cover 9 at intervals of one end. Correspondingly, the second front neck-surrounding lower cover 41 is provided with third protrusions 16 at intervals of one end, and the third protrusions 16 are inserted into the third grooves 15 to fix the second front neck-surrounding upper cover 9 and the second front neck-surrounding lower cover 41. The first groove 36 comprises a through hole formed in the front end of the second front scarf upper cover 9 and a clamping groove 11 formed between the second front scarf upper cover 9 and the second front scarf lower cover 41, and the first magnetic attraction piece 12 is arranged in the clamping groove 11, preferably, the diameter of the clamping groove 11 is smaller than that of the through hole.
Further, as shown in fig. 3, the first protrusion 37 is provided at the front end of the first front scarf 5, the first front scarf 5 includes a first front scarf upper cover 17 and a first front scarf lower cover 18 fixed up and down, and a third groove 15 is provided at a distance from one end of the middle partition of the first front scarf upper cover 17. Correspondingly, the first front neck-surrounding lower cover 18 is provided with third protrusions 16 at intervals of one end, and the third protrusions 16 are inserted into the third grooves 15 to fix the first front neck-surrounding upper cover 17 and the first front neck-surrounding lower cover 18. The first protrusion 37 includes a half protrusion of the front end of the first front neck-surrounding upper cover 17 and a half protrusion of the front end of the first front neck-surrounding lower cover 18, and the first protrusion 37 is synthesized when the half protrusion of the front end of the first front neck-surrounding upper cover 17 and the half protrusion of the front end of the first front neck-surrounding lower cover 18 are fixed together. The first projection 37 comprises two projections, the first projection at the foremost end having a smaller diameter than the second projection. The second magnetic attraction piece 21 is arranged in a first section of protrusion of the first protrusion 37, a clamping seat 22 is arranged in the first section of protrusion of the first protrusion 37, and the second magnetic attraction piece 21 is arranged on the clamping seat 22.
When the first front scarf 5 and the second front scarf 4 are connected, the first section of the first protrusion 37 is inserted into the clamping groove 11, and the first magnetic attraction piece 12 and the second magnetic attraction piece 21 are connected. The second section of the first bulge 37 is inserted into the through hole, the first through hole 10 and the second front scarf upper cover 9 are integrally formed, and the second section of the first bulge 37 is tightly tied, so that the connection between the first front scarf 5 and the second front scarf 4 is firmer.
Preferably, as shown in fig. 2, 3 and 6, the two ends of the rear scarf 7 are provided with second protrusions 35, the rear end of the first front scarf 5 and the rear end of the second front scarf 4 are provided with second grooves 14, the rear end of the first front scarf upper cover 17 and the rear end of the second front scarf upper cover 9 are provided with second through holes 13, and the second through holes 13 are arranged on the second grooves 14. Further, the second through hole 13 at the rear end of the first front scarf upper cover 17 and the second through hole 13 at the rear end of the second front scarf upper cover 9 are formed integrally, the second protrusion 35 is inserted into the second through hole 13, and the second through hole 13 is used for tightening the second protrusion 35.
Preferably, as shown in fig. 6, the utility model is hung at the rear neck of the user during use, and the rear scarf 7 is made of soft rubber, so that the use experience of the user can be improved.
Preferably, at least 1 of the first magnetic attraction member 12 and the second magnetic attraction member 21 is made of a magnetic material, and the other is made of a magneto-philic material, so that the first front scarf 5 and the second front scarf 4 are connected. Among these, a nucleophilic material is understood to be a related material that is capable of being attracted to a magnetic material. For example, when the magnetic material is a magnet, the nucleophilic material may be iron or other material that is attracted to the magnet. On the other hand, the first magnetic attraction member 12 and the second magnetic attraction member 21 may be made of magnetic materials, and when they are made of magnetic materials, they are assembled in such a manner that the first front muffler 5 and the second front muffler 4 are connected. If the first magnetic attraction member 12 and the second magnetic attraction member 21 are both magnets, the polarities facing the card holder 22 should be the same polarity, for example, if the polarity of the first magnetic attraction member 12 facing the card holder 22 is N, then the polarity of the second magnetic attraction member 21 facing the card holder 22 should be N.
Preferably, as shown in fig. 4, the scarf joint 3 comprises a plug 28 and a fixed seat 27, the fixed seat 27 being arranged above the second front scarf upper cover 9. The connecting rod 2 is inserted into the plug 28 and fixed with the plug 28, the plug 28 is inserted into the fixed seat 27 and fixed with the second front scarf 9 by arranging the fastener 23.
Preferably, as shown in fig. 5, one end of the connecting rod 2 is fixed to the plug 28, and the other end is provided with a sleeve 29 and a fixing ball 30, and preferably, the sleeve 29 and the fixing ball 30 are integrally formed. The fixing ball 30 is provided on the sleeve 29, and the connecting rod 2 is inserted into the sleeve 29 to be fixed with the sleeve 29. Further, the clamping device 1 is provided with an interface 32, the interface 32 is arranged at the rear end of the clamping device 1, and the fixing ball 30 is inserted into the interface 32, so that the fixing ball 30 can be tightly bound in the interface 32. Through clamping device connects 8, the user can be according to the direction of self demand adjustment clamping device 1, has promoted user's use experience.
In the first embodiment, as shown in fig. 7 and 8, the front ends of the first front scarf 5 and the second front scarf 4 are provided with magnetic structures, and when the user uses the utility model, the user opens the first front scarf 5 to sleeve the utility model on the neck.
In the second embodiment, the arrangement of the first front scarf 5 and the second front scarf 4 in the first embodiment is interchanged, and when the user uses the present utility model, the user opens the second front scarf 4 to put the present utility model around the neck.
In the third embodiment, the rear end of the first front scarf 5 and one end of the rear scarf 7 are provided with magnetic attraction structures, and when the user uses the utility model, the user opens the rear scarf 7 to sleeve the utility model on the neck.
The specific use process of the utility model is as follows: firstly, when the utility model is used, a user opens the first front scarf 5 or the second front scarf 4, then hangs the rear scarf 7 on the neck, and then inserts the first front scarf 5 and the second front scarf 4 to finish wearing. The utility model adopts the sectional scarf structure, so that a user does not need to sleeve the bracket from the head into the neck, and when the scarf is used, the pluggable scarf bracket is separated and then can be worn, and when the scarf is taken down, the first front scarf 5 and the second front scarf 4 can be directly separated and then taken down from the neck, thereby being convenient for the user to wear and take down. Furthermore, the magnetic attraction structure is further arranged in the plug-in structure to provide magnetic attraction and retention for the plug-in state, so that the use of the plug-in structure by a user is facilitated. The back scarf is deformable structure, and the user can adjust back scarf 7 according to self actual demand, has promoted user's use experience.
